Tutti Market is a compact neighborhood grocery store in the small town of Skærbæk in southwest Jutland. Stocking everyday Danish staples alongside international products, it serves as a practical stop for self-catering travelers, cyclists, and road-trippers exploring the Wadden Sea coast. With straightforward aisles, friendly local feel, and essentials for picnics or holiday homes, it’s an easy, fuss-free place to restock between sightseeing stops.

Local tips
- Plan your visit for mid-morning or early afternoon to avoid local after-work rushes at the checkout.
- Use this as your main stop for breakfast items, snacks, and picnic supplies if you are staying in a nearby holiday home or campsite.
- Bring a reusable shopping bag, as Danish grocery stores often charge for carrier bags and encourage waste reduction.
- Check chilled and frozen sections for easy dinner options if you want to cook quickly after a day exploring the coast.
- Have a payment card ready, as card payments are widely accepted and often preferred in Danish supermarkets.

Everyday hub in a quiet Jutland town
Tutti Market sits in the modest townscape of Skærbæk, a low-rise community close to the Wadden Sea and the causeway to Rømø. This is not a sprawling hypermarket but a human-scale grocery where locals pick up their daily bread, milk, and fresh produce. Its compact footprint makes it easy to navigate, with a simple layout that quickly orients you from entrance to checkout. The atmosphere reflects the town around it: calm, unhurried, and practical. Shelves are packed more for usefulness than display, but you’ll still find small touches that signal a locally rooted business, from familiar Danish brands to handwritten offers.
